Ledger Co-Founder's kidnapping serves as a stark reminder to prioritize security in the crypto world.
- On January 21, David Balland and his wife are kidnapped from their residence and taken to separate locations.
- The abductors demand a ransom of 100 BTC (approximately $10 million) from another co-founder, reportedly Éric Larchevêque, and send one of David’s severed fingers as evidence.
- A portion of the ransom is paid to stall for time.
- GIGN, France's elite unit, successfully locates and rescues David.
- Hours later, they also rescue his wife, who is discovered tied up in a car.
- Most of the ransom is traced and frozen.
